Orchard 1.9.1 Расположение контейнера

Я установил следующее определение контента на сайте Orchard 1.9.1:

Manufacturer
  - Logo (Media Library Picker Field)
  - Container (single supported type - Product)

Product
  - Containable
  - [Generic Fields]

Я добавил несколько образцов Product элементы на сайт, и в качестве части этого я выбрал Member Of вариант, который был список Manufacturer предметы, которые я уже добавил.

У меня проблема в том, что когда я пытаюсь построить запрос для использования с виджетом проекции, я не могу найти способ получить Manufacturerдети, или Productродительский контейнер, так как мне нужно отобразить все содержимое в одном представлении. Здесь будет всего около 20 позиций, поэтому производительность не является проблемой. Если я делаю несколько запросов (по одному для каждого типа), все отображается отдельно, кроме инструмента "Отслеживание формы", когда я показываю различные Model Похоже, что элементы на представлении не могут показать мне ни один из этих вариантов.

Моя конечная цель - создание собственного представления для отображения этой информации, но я не могу понять, как пройти через Product к тому, что его родительский контейнер, или пройти вниз от Manufacturer ребенку Product предметы под ним.

Как мне создать запрос, который позволит мне увидеть все это, чтобы я мог создать виджет проекции из этого?

редактировать

Я поиграл с этим еще немного и натолкнулся на возможность взять запрос и прикрепить к нему макет. Это определенно приближает меня, однако вариант группировки говорит No properties are currently available in order to group this viewОднако я думаю, что принадлежность к контейнеру / контейнеру автоматически определит группировку. В настоящее время это позволяет мне показать все, но, к сожалению, родитель / потомок показывают, а потом дети повторяются снова, независимо от родителя. Это так близко, но я не могу понять это правильно.

0 ответов

Другие вопросы по тегам